发布日期:2025-06-18 17:56:06
FileZilla是一款广泛使用的FTP(File Transfer Protocol,文件传输协议)客户端软件,用于在本地计算机和远程服务器之间传输文件。然而,有时会遇到FileZilla无法连接服务器的问题,这会给文件传输工作带来不便。下面将详细分析可能的原因,并给出相应的解决办法。
网络连接是使用FileZilla连接服务器的基础。若网络连接不稳定或中断,自然无法连接服务器。
可以先检查本地设备的网络连接状态。查看Wi-Fi是否正常连接,或者有线网络的网线是否插好。打开浏览器,尝试访问一些常见的网站,如百度、谷歌等,以此判断网络是否正常。
若网络连接存在问题,可以尝试重新启动路由器或调制解调器。关闭设备电源,等待几分钟后再重新开启,让设备重新连接网络。
连接服务器时,输入的服务器信息必须准确无误。这些信息包括服务器地址、端口号、用户名和密码。
服务器地址通常是域名或IP地址。要确保输入的地址正确,可向服务器管理员确认。端口号方面,FTP默认端口是21,但有些服务器可能会使用其他端口,需确认并正确输入。
用户名和密码是登录服务器的凭证,要保证输入的信息与服务器设置一致。若忘记密码,可以联系服务器管理员重置。
防火墙和安全软件可能会阻止FileZilla与服务器的连接。它们会根据预设规则,限制某些程序的网络访问。
先查看本地防火墙设置。以Windows系统为例,打开“控制面板”,找到“Windows Defender防火墙”,在“允许的应用”中查看FileZilla是否被允许通过防火墙。若未允许,点击“允许其他应用”,找到FileZilla程序并添加。
对于安全软件,如360安全卫士、电脑管家等,检查其网络防护设置,确保FileZilla没有被限制网络访问。
FileZilla支持主动模式和被动模式两种连接方式。当一种模式无法连接时,可以尝试另一种。
主动模式下,服务器主动向客户端发起数据连接;被动模式下,客户端主动向服务器发起数据连接。在FileZilla的“编辑”菜单中选择“设置”,在“连接” - “FTP”中可以切换连接模式。
旧版本的FileZilla可能存在一些漏洞或兼容性问题,导致无法连接服务器。
可以访问FileZilla官方网站,下载最新版本的软件。安装新版本后,再次尝试连接服务器。
1. 更换连接模式后还是无法连接服务器怎么办?
若更换连接模式后仍无法连接,可进一步检查服务器端的设置。联系服务器管理员,确认服务器是否支持所选的连接模式,以及服务器的FTP服务是否正常运行。也可以尝试使用其他FTP客户端软件,如FlashFXP等,看能否连接服务器,以此判断是软件问题还是服务器问题。
2. 检查防火墙设置后还是不行,还有其他可能的原因吗?
除了防火墙,网络代理也可能影响连接。若使用了代理服务器,检查代理设置是否正确,或者尝试关闭代理。另外,服务器可能存在负载过高的情况,导致无法响应连接请求,可以稍后再尝试连接。同时,服务器的FTP服务可能出现故障,需联系服务器管理员排查。